I am getting the error:

"Check the info you entered. It doesn't match the info for this card" When trying to register a card. I've tried using different Microsoft accounts, I've reviewed all the card and address details, I've tested several cards from different banks and the problem still persists. I've seen countless posts from people reporting the problem and none of them helped me, I can't contact support. This is very frustrating, I've already wasted hours on this.
